summ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orJon Marius Venstad <venstad@gmail.com>2019-02-08 09:52:18 +0100
committerJon Marius Venstad <venstad@gmail.com>2019-02-08 09:52:18 +0100
commit4d6da807c84c8fbd6209068d0b6efeec8c9332ee (patch)
treebe172606b2a8ef6a17a6a8ba68dc047499d33e92
parentd2419acb0eae2e9d4895d82607dd64aac563aafa (diff)
Actually make sure cache is up-to-date while lock is held
-rw-r--r--orchestrator/src/main/java/com/yahoo/vespa/orchestrator/status/ZookeeperStatusService.java1
1 files changed, 1 insertions, 0 deletions
diff --git a/orchestrator/src/main/java/com/yahoo/vespa/orchestrator/status/ZookeeperStatusService.java b/orchestrator/src/main/java/com/yahoo/vespa/orchestrator/status/ZookeeperStatusService.java
index a167e185012..4636457f522 100644
--- a/orchestrator/src/main/java/com/yahoo/vespa/orchestrator/status/ZookeeperStatusService.java
+++ b/orchestrator/src/main/java/com/yahoo/vespa/orchestrator/status/ZookeeperStatusService.java
@@ -139,6 +139,7 @@ public class ZookeeperStatusService implements StatusService {
}
finally {
counter.next();
+ hostsDown.remove(applicationInstanceReference);
}
}